GPT-6 Astra API & Pricing Guide

A practical guide to the GPT-6 Astra model ID, token pricing, long-context surcharge, reasoning controls, agent features and cost management.

GPT-6 Astra API model ID

Use gpt-6-astra in API requests. OpenAI recommends the Responses API for reasoning and tool-heavy workloads, while the model page also lists Chat Completions support.

The model supports low, medium, high, xhigh and max reasoning effort. Astra does not support a none reasoning setting.

Current GPT-6 Astra pricing

At publication time, Standard text pricing per 1 million tokens is $10 input, $1 cached input, $12.50 cache writes and $50 output. Tool-specific features such as search or computer use can have additional per-tool charges.

Batch and Flex are priced at 50% of Standard rates. Fast mode is priced at 2x applicable rates where supported, and OpenAI says Fast mode is unavailable for Astra with EU data residency.

Long-context pricing and context limits

Astra has a 1,050,000-token context window and a 128,000-token maximum output. That can accommodate very large repositories and document sets, but using the full window is not automatically economical.

If a prompt exceeds 272K input tokens, OpenAI prices the full request at 2x input and cache rates and 1.5x output rates. Retrieval, prompt caching, compaction and tighter context selection can therefore materially affect cost.

Async tool calling and mid-turn steering

Async tool calling lets the model continue other work while your application runs a slow function or custom tool marked asynchronous. Your application still executes the tool and returns the result using the original call ID.

Mid-turn steering lets a user change requirements while a response is already running over WebSocket. Astra can preserve completed work and continue with the updated instruction instead of discarding the whole task.

Reasoning controls and cost management

Astra supports configuration updates that can raise or lower reasoning effort during a conversation while preserving the original cached prompt prefix. Higher effort can improve difficult planning or reasoning, but it can also increase latency and billed output-token usage.

For production systems, compare success rate, latency and full task cost rather than defaulting every request to max reasoning. Use cheaper models for routine work, prompt caching for stable repeated context, and Batch or Flex where latency requirements allow.

Rate limits and deployment checks

The current model page lists no Free-tier support. Published paid-tier limits range from Tier 1 at 500 requests per minute and 500,000 tokens per minute to Tier 5 at 15,000 requests per minute and 40,000,000 tokens per minute.
